Sergei Anatolyevitch Torop (; born 14 January 1961), known as Vissarion (, "He who gives new life" or "life-giving"), is a Russian spiritual teacher, self proclaimed reincarnation of Jesus, and founder of the non-profit religious organization , described by many organizations as a cult.

According to the followers of Sergei Torop and some of his own explanations, on 18 August 1990, at the age of 29, Sergey had a “spiritual awakening”. He gave his first public teaching after awakening in Minusinsk on 18 August 1991.
